On Fri, Aug 21, 2015 at 11:09:20AM +0200, Marek Vasut wrote:
> The problem this patch is trying to address is such, that SPI NOR flash
> devices attached to a dedicated SPI NOR controller cannot read their
> properties from the associated struct device_node.
>
> A couple of facts first:
> 1) Each SPI NOR flash has a struct spi_nor associated with it.
> 2) Each SPI NOR flash has certain device properties associated
> with it, for example the OF property 'm25p,fast-read' is a
> good pick. These properties are used by the SPI NOR core to
> select which opcodes are sent to such SPI NOR flash. These
> properties are coming from spi_nor .dev->device_node .
>
> The problem is, that for SPI NOR controllers, the struct spi_nor .dev
> element points to the struct device of the SPI NOR controller, not the
> SPI NOR flash. Therefore, the associated dev->device_node also is the
> one of the controller and therefore the SPI NOR core code is trying to
> parse the SPI NOR controller's properties, not the properties of the
> SPI NOR flash.
>
> Note: The m25p80 driver is not affected, because the controller and
> the flash are the same device, so the associated device_node
> of the controller and the flash are the same.
>
> This patch adjusts the SPI NOR core such that the device_node is not
> picked from spi_nor .dev directly, but from a new separate spi_nor .dn
> element.
